Disney is sending out a 2026 Disney World Calendar to Annual Passholders — look how adorable it is!

2026 Annual Pass calendar!

The calendar comes with a bunch of stickers that you can place on dates.

  • Disney Park icons – Tower of Terror, Spaceship Earth, Cinderella Castle, and the Tree of Life.
  • Iconic Disney World attractions – Space Mountain, Big Thunder Mountain, Safari, the train, and Tea Cups.
  • Disney celebration buttons that you can use for birthdays and other big days.
  • Annual Pass icons.
  • Stickers for different start dates at Disney World, including the holidays, Food and Wine, Halloween, Festival of the Arts, and more!
  • Plus other fun and adorable stickers!
Stickers for dates!

The first page of the calendar has a message to Passholders, as well as a big cartoon display of the four parks at Disney World.

Alright, let’s take a look at all the months, which is what we’re really excited for. January features Figment — he’s holding a paint bucket and flying through the sky.

February features Princess Tiana and Louis — they’re putting on a performance. Look at the little critters joining them on stage. Also, can you see Ray in the bottom left corner!

March features the Orange Bird — he’s just chilling by a tree with a refreshing Dole Whip treat. We love all the oranges that cover this page of the calendar.

April features Minnie Mouse — she’s enjoying the coming of spring as the page is decorated with flowers.

May features Oswald — the page is in black and white, and has that classic vintage feel to it.

June features Stitch — it looks like he couldn’t help himself from ripping through the page!

July features Dumbo — he’s flying about the Magic Kingdom as the fireworks are going off. We love how you can see the iconic attractions in Fantasyland!

August features Timon and Pumba — they’re enjoying a very gross snack. You’ll also see bugs crawling around the page.

September features Mickey Mouse — it looks like he’s just enjoying taking a stroll in the nice weather. It feels like we can hear him singing “nothing can stop us now”.

October features Princess Aurora and Maleficent — it’s the iconic scene from Disney’s Sleeping Beauty. This page has the most unique look in the calendar, as it features a different design for the month name and page. It takes elements from the iconic Disney movie into its design.

November features Hei Hei — he’s just up to his usual shenanigans!

December features tons of Disney characters! This page almost brings it all together in a snowflake design.
